Дипломная работа: Разработка автоматизированной информационной системы "Библиотека ВУЗа"
1.2 Просмотр отчетов по запросам.
2. Составление карточки читателя.
2.1. Запись нового читателя.
2.1.1 Ввод книг выдаваемых читателю.
2.2. Получение отчетов карточки читателя и выданных ему книгах.
3. Ввод данных о читателях задолжниках.
3.1 Ввод данных.
3.2 Получение отчетов о текущих задолжниках.
4. Поиск книги.
4.1 Выбор критерия поиска.
4.1.1 Получение отчетов о результате поиска.
5. Выход из программы.
6. Справка.
Представление графа сценария задачи представлено на рисунке 1.
Рис.1 Граф сценария задачи «Библиотека вуза»
3.2 Разработка контекстной диаграммы
Контекстной диаграмма позволяет наглядно представить бизнес-процессы, протекающие в данной информационной системе, документооборот и информационные массивы При построении данной диаграммы используется принцип иерархического упорядочивания – принцип организации составных частей системы. Построение иерархии диаграмм начинается с построения системы в виде простейшего компонента – одного блока и дуг. Дуги – это функции данной системы (входные и выходные данные, механизм работы системы и управляющая информация). Полученная модель может служить основой для создания программно-информационной системы.
Контекстная диаграмма показана на рисунке 2.
Рисунок 2 – Контекстная диаграмма
3.3 Разработка программной системы
3.3.1 Описание системы с использованием языка моделирования UML
Приступим к созданию модели приложения «Библиотеки вуза». На основе описанных требований и ограничений выделим классы пользователей системы, определим требования к ним и дадим описание системы с точки зрения пользователя. В системе обозначений UML таким описанием является представление использования (Use-Case View). Это представление может состоять из нескольких диаграмм использования (Use-Case Diagram), которые описывают отдельные части системы и систему в целом. Сначала составим диаграмму использования, описывающую систему в целом
Описание системы с данного языка моделирования представлено на рисунках 3,4.
| |
Рисунок 4 – Представление работы системы в целом
Рисунок 4 – Представление работы системы в целом
3.3.2Технология проектирования баз данных
База данных – специальным образом организованная совокупность данных большого объема и сложной структуры, построенная с учетом принципов интеграции, обеспечивающая одноразовый ввод данных и их многоаспектное использование.
В основу проектирования базы данных должны быть положены представления конечных пользователей конкретной организации – концептуальные требования к системе. От оперативности и качества информации будет зависеть эффективность работы организации.
При рассмотрении требований конечных пользователей необходимо принимать во внимание следующее:
- База данных должна удовлетворять актуальным информационным потребностям организации. Получаемая информация должна по структуре и содержанию соответствовать решаемым задачам.
- База данных должна обеспечивать получение требуемых данных за приемлемое время, т. е. отвечать заданным требованиям производительности.
- База данных должна удовлетворять выявленным и вновь возникающим требованиям конечных пользователей.
- База данных должна легко расширяться при реорганизации и расширении предметной области.
- База данных должна легко изменяться при изменении программной и аппаратной среды.